Going forward, every zero-downtime schema change on the Castello database follows the expand/backfill/contract sequence, with the contract step gated on a verified row-parity check. Support should expect a read-only banner only during the parity check, never during backfill. The timing constants that define each phase, which you can quote to customers when estimating windows, are listed below.

tuning constants:
QUOTAS = {
    "druwyn": 5,
    "holix": 5,
    "zorath": 5,
    "holwyn": 10,
}

Ticket: TaxGrid lookup cache failing on refresh. The credentials used by the Quillbrook tax-rate lookup cache expired overnight, so every cache miss now falls through to the slow path and release validation is blocked. I've provisioned a replacement credential scoped to read-only rate tables, verified it against staging, and confirmed no other services share the old one. For the release checklist, the new key is below.

app token of yajeg-kawef = kto11_7En3XSX8xQw

When the Tokenmill refresh daemon drops mid-rotation, active session tokens expire without renewal and operators lose access to the Larkspur admin plane. This is a known race in the v4 refresher; do not restart the daemon blindly, as that invalidates the pending grant table. Instead, use the break-glass path: authenticate against the standby issuer in Coldport, which bypasses Tokenmill entirely. The standby issuer prompts for the emergency recovery passphrase before minting a scoped token. Enter it exactly as recorded below.

unlock words, hahip-baduf: holwyn-istath-julvan